Having a sensory-friendly wedding for neurodiverse people | Nottingham & Lincolnshire natural wedding photographer

Will there be neurodiverse people at your wedding? Here at Victoria Louise Wedding Photographer, I love to help couples navigate through the world of wedding planning, so here are 3 incredibly packed full-filed tips to help inspire your wedding planning for the perfect wedding day!

1: Create a sensory relaxing time-out space.

This could be a large tablecloth over a table, with fidget toys and cushions in the quietest area of your venue if you're on a budget. Or you can hire a company for a sensory space and have it in another room away from the party to allow guests to have a chill space away from all the stimulation. Make sure this space is just for the neurodiverse people, it is not to be shared, without permission from the neurodiverse person, because it will be their safe space.

2: Provide earplugs, or ear defenders on a little table next to the dance floor with sensory relaxing toys.

Loud noise can be overwhelming for neurodiverse people. You could also ask the DJ not to use strobe lighting, which can affect neurodiverse people and epileptics. Choosing suppliers who are experienced with neurodiversity and letting them know, can also help make everything run smoothly.

3: Every person is unique, so do ask your guests what they think would make them feel comfortable, by preparing with a pre-wedding meeting. Doing anything out of routine and the unknown can cause much anxiety, having a walk through the venue for them to see where they will be and help them prepare in advance may be able to help them. Remember to be flexible, Neurodiverse people may have a meltdown (yes adults too!) And may not be able to wear the dress code due to sensory issues.
